April is PI Awareness Month

April is the national awareness month for Primary Immunodeficiency and April 22-29 is World PI Week. With your help, we can raise awareness and increase the understanding of primary immunodeficiency diseases (PI), which can lead to earlier diagnosis and better care for those affected by PI.

ImmUnity Canada is a national charity with five provincial chapters across the country.

We empower Canadians impacted by immunodeficiency disorders to live well through education, support, advocacy, community-building, and research.
